Le Monde: Life imitates art as award-winning migrant actor granted visa to stay in France
Life imitates art as award-winning migrant actor granted visa to stay in France
Abou Sangare, a 23-year-old undocumented Guinean migrant in France, has received a one-year work permit, avoiding deportation. He gained recognition for his role in "L'Histoire de Souleymane," reflecting his own experiences as an immigrant.

Sangare plans to pursue a job as a mechanic instead of a film career, emphasizing his trade over potential acting offers. His journey to France involved perilous travel across several countries to support his mother's medical needs.

Breitbart: California Rules Caused Insurance Companies to Cancel Policies Before Wildfires
California Rules Caused Insurance Companies to Cancel Policies Before Wildfires
California's insurance crisis has led to many residents, particularly in fire-prone areas like Pacific Palisades, losing their home insurance policies just before wildfires. Insurance companies are halting new policies due to rising risks and costs, exacerbated by state regulations that restrict pricing based on future risks.

California's Insurance Commissioner Ricardo Lara has announced new regulations aimed at expanding coverage in high-risk areas, but these changes came too late for many homeowners. Critics argue that state policies intended to keep insurance affordable are driving companies out of the market, leaving residents vulnerable.

Times Of Israel: ‘Violation of international norms’: Biblical map of Israel sparks outrage from Jordan
‘Violation of international norms’: Biblical map of Israel sparks outrage from Jordan
A map of ancient Israel published by the official Israel Arabic account has sparked backlash from Jordan, which accused Israel of inciting conflict. The map highlights historical boundaries from 928 BC, but Jordan's Foreign Ministry condemned it as inflammatory and a violation of international norms.

The UAE also criticized the map, viewing it as an attempt to expand occupation and disrupt peace efforts. Both nations called for an end to provocative actions that threaten stability and the two-state solution.


Forbes: Denmark Says It’s Open To Conversations With Trump—But Greenland Won’t Become A US State
Denmark Says It’s Open To Conversations With Trump—But Greenland Won’t Become A US State
Denmark's Foreign Minister Lars Løkke Rasmussen expressed openness to dialogue with the U.S. regarding cooperation in Greenland, following President-elect Donald Trump's comments about military force to secure the territory. Rasmussen acknowledged the region's strategic importance amid rising great power rivalry.

Trump has previously suggested Greenland's acquisition for national security, while Danish leaders, including Prime Minister Mette Frederiksen, downplayed concerns over military action, emphasizing Greenland's desire for independence and self-determination.
